Only open a credit card at a retail store if you shop there often. When a store runs a credit check to see if you qualify for a card, it shows up on your credit report, even if you ultimately decide not to open an account. If you’re declined by a few retail chains, for example, you can actually hurt your credit rating in the long term.

Public Computers

Do not use public computers to make purchases with a credit card. Your information may be stored, making you susceptible to having your information stolen. Entering confidential information, like your credit card number, into these public computers is very irresponsible. You should only shop online from a computer that you own.

Avoid prepaid cards when you are looking for a secured card. This is because they are classified as debit cards, so they will do nothing to help your credit score improve. Many of them charge extra fees as well, and all they are is another checking account. Put down a deposit and get yourself an actual secured credit card so that it reports to the credit bureaus, improving your score.

Discuss lowering your interest rates with the credit card companies you use. Sometimes, especially if you have a long and positive history as a customer, companies are willing to reduce their interest rates. It could save you a lot of money and there is no cost to asking for it.

Review each of your credit statements closely. Try to identify problems with the charges for which you know you are responsible, and look for entries indicating purchases that you know you never made. Report any discrepancies to the credit card company right away. This keeps you from paying more than you should, and it can also protect your credit score.

The reason a credit card company will ask you to make a minimum payment is because they want you to pay this amount over time to make the most money off of you. Always pay more than just the minimum amount required. This helps you steer clear of expensive interest payments down the road.

Know the interest rate you are getting. You should completely understand the interest rate prior to signing up for a credit card. If you take a card with a high interest rate, you could pay two or three times the cost of your original purchase over time. If the interest rate is too high, you might find yourself carrying a bigger and bigger balance over each month.

Watch your credit balance cautiously. Be sure you know your card’s limit before making purchases. Going over your credit limit will raise your fees and your overall debt. If you continually keep your balance over the limit, the fees will continue to add up and you will have difficulty getting your balance paid down.

Always read the terms and conditions of your card before using it. The first use of your card is perceived as an acceptance of its terms by most credit card issuers. The print on the agreement may be small, but it is important to read it carefully.

Sign the back of your credit card as soon as you receive it to avoid fraudulent use. Many cashiers will check to make sure there are matching signatures before finalizing the sale.

If you want a good credit card, be mindful of your credit score. Credit card companies use those credit scores for determining the cards to offer customers. Cards with more perks and lower interest rates are offered to people with higher credit scores.
